Why Standard Labels Often Fail in the UAE

Many businesses use generic paper or low-quality adhesive labels that are not designed for harsh conditions.

Common issues include:

  • Fading due to UV exposure
  • Peeling caused by heat
  • Adhesive failure on outdoor surfaces
  • Damage from dust and moisture
  • Barcodes becoming unreadable

When labels fail, businesses lose visibility of assets, increase manual work, and face inventory and maintenance challenges.

Key Environmental Factors to Consider

Before choosing a label material, evaluate where the asset will be used.

Extreme Heat

In many parts of the UAE, outdoor temperatures can exceed 45°C during summer months.

Labels exposed to:

  • Construction sites
  • Vehicle fleets
  • Outdoor equipment
  • Industrial machinery

must be able to withstand prolonged heat without shrinking, cracking, or peeling.

UV Exposure

Continuous sunlight can cause printed information and barcodes to fade.

Look for:

  • UV-resistant materials
  • Fade-resistant printing technology
  • Outdoor-grade laminates

Dust and Sand

Dust and sand are common across many UAE industries.

Labels should:

  • Resist abrasion
  • Protect printed data
  • Maintain barcode readability

Moisture and Humidity

Although the UAE is known for its dry climate, coastal locations and industrial environments often experience high humidity.

Labels must withstand:

  • Cleaning chemicals
  • Water exposure
  • Condensation
  • Humid storage conditions

Polyester Labels: A Popular Choice for UAE Businesses

Polyester labels are among the most widely used materials for asset identification.

Benefits:

  • Excellent heat resistance
  • Strong chemical resistance
  • Durable adhesive performance
  • Scratch-resistant surface
  • Long-term barcode readability

Best for:

  • IT assets
  • Office equipment
  • Healthcare devices
  • Manufacturing facilities
  • Warehouses

Metal Asset Tags for Extreme Conditions

For the harshest environments, metal asset tags provide exceptional durability.

Benefits:

  • High temperature resistance
  • UV-proof performance
  • Long lifespan
  • Excellent resistance to chemicals and abrasion

Best for:

  • Oil and gas facilities
  • Construction equipment
  • Heavy machinery
  • Outdoor infrastructure
  • Utility assets

Vinyl Labels for Outdoor Applications

Vinyl labels are flexible and designed for outdoor conditions.

Benefits:

  • Weather resistant
  • UV stable
  • Suitable for curved surfaces
  • Strong adhesion

Best for:

  • Fleet vehicles
  • Outdoor equipment
  • Facility management assets
  • Logistics containers

RFID Labels for Advanced Asset Tracking

Businesses adopting digital asset management increasingly use RFID labels.

Benefits:

  • Contactless scanning
  • Faster inventory management
  • Real-time asset visibility
  • Reduced manual tracking

Best for:

  • Healthcare facilities
  • Warehouses
  • Construction projects
  • Logistics operations

Choosing the Right Adhesive

The label material is only part of the solution—the adhesive is equally important.

Factors to consider:

  • Surface type (metal, plastic, glass, painted surfaces)
  • Indoor or outdoor use
  • Exposure to chemicals
  • Temperature fluctuations

Industrial-grade adhesives are essential for assets exposed to UAE weather conditions.

Questions to Ask Before Selecting a Label Material

Before ordering labels, consider:

  • Will the asset be used indoors or outdoors?
  • What temperatures will it be exposed to?
  • Will it encounter chemicals or cleaning agents?
  • How long should the label last?
  • Do you need barcode or RFID functionality?
  • What surface will the label be applied to?

Answering these questions helps ensure you choose the most effective solution.
